@Troy_Baverstock many diy laser cutters are just using the universal gcode sender to stream gcode to the arduino. Then there is the lasersaur project which has a web interface, but I don’t know in which state this currently is. VisiCut is a java program aiming to be a laser cutter software for every laser cutter. Finally allow me to point to our own @Mr_Beam software, an open source web interface for grbl driven lasercutters.
